Available for projects

Backend engineer.
AI researcher.
Security breaker.

Building multi-agent systems that work in production — not demos. 12 years of backend engineering underneath. Active security researcher who thinks about how agents break, not just how they work.

Multi-Agent Systems Claude API / Agent SDK Agent Orchestration Agent Verification Go Node.js Distributed Systems Bug Bounty DevOps
AI-native. Backend-proven.

I build autonomous multi-agent systems that run in production — orchestrating fleets of AI workers with tool access, memory, and verification layers. Not prototypes. Real agentic workflows that handle execution at scale.

Under the hood: 12 years of backend engineering in Go and Node.js — distributed systems, event-driven architectures, and APIs that handle millions of requests. That's the foundation that makes AI systems reliable.

The other edge: I'm an active bug bounty hunter on HackerOne. When you're building autonomous agents with tool access, understanding the attack surface isn't optional — it's the difference between a demo and a product.

0
Years Engineering
0
Projects Shipped
0
Bugs Reported
0
Agent Systems Built
What I build with AI

Production agentic systems — multi-agent orchestration, autonomous execution, and the verification layers that make them trustworthy.

AEGIS

AI-powered threat modelling CLI. An autonomous agent that reads filesystems, analyses codebases, and produces security assessments — built with the Claude Agent SDK with real tool access.

Claude Agent SDK Node.js Filesystem Tools CLI
Autonomous analysis Real filesystem access Tool-use patterns Security-focused
AI ↔ Slack Pipeline

Autonomous AI automation system. Claude Code hooks that read transcripts, convert to Slack mrkdwn, post to channels, and poll for human replies to feed back — a full human-in-the-loop autonomous workflow.

Claude Code Hooks Slack API Shell JSONL
Headless execution Human-in-the-loop Transcript parsing Bidirectional feedback

Agent Orchestration

Multi-agent coordination Agent-to-agent verification Task decomposition Context window management Tool-use routing Memory & state

LLM Engineering

Claude API / Agent SDK Prompt engineering Tokenization (BPE) RLHF / PPO Function calling Structured outputs

Agent Security

Prompt injection defense Tenant isolation Tool privilege escalation Data leakage prevention Agent guardrails Output validation
The foundation

12 years of backend engineering that makes AI systems reliable at scale.

Languages

Go JavaScript TypeScript Python Rust C/C++ Java Bash SQL

Backend

Gin / Echo / Fiber Express / Fastify NestJS gRPC GraphQL REST APIs WebSockets Microservices

Databases

PostgreSQL Redis MongoDB Elasticsearch DynamoDB Kafka RabbitMQ

Cloud & DevOps

AWS GCP Docker Kubernetes Terraform GitHub Actions Linux CI/CD

Architecture

Distributed Systems Event-Driven System Design CQRS Domain-Driven Design Clean Architecture

Security

Penetration Testing Bug Bounty OWASP Top 10 Burp Suite API Security Code Auditing
Security tools

Security-focused CLI tools written in Go. Zero dependencies, single binaries.

Career timeline

From backend systems to AI agent engineering — building and securing at scale.

2024 — Present

AI Agent Engineer & Senior Backend Freelancer

Building multi-agent AI systems in production — autonomous agent orchestration, verification layers, and tool-use pipelines using Claude API and Agent SDK. Concurrent bug bounty hunting on HackerOne (Robinhood, Airbnb scopes).

Multi-Agent Systems Claude API Agent Verification Go Node.js Bug Bounty
2020 — 2024

Lead Backend Engineer

Led teams building high-throughput distributed systems processing millions of daily transactions. Designed event-driven architectures and API gateways — the exact infrastructure patterns that underpin reliable AI agent systems.

Distributed Systems Event-Driven API Gateways Team Lead
2017 — 2020

Senior Software Engineer

Migrated monoliths to microservices. Built real-time data pipelines and CI/CD workflows. Introduced Go to the engineering team.

Microservices Data Pipelines Go
2014 — 2017

Backend Developer

Built RESTful APIs, database schemas, and server-side logic. First exposure to cybersecurity through CTF competitions.

APIs Node.js Python
2012 — 2014

Junior Developer

Started the journey. Wrote code in everything. Fell in love with backend systems and learned that production is a different beast.

The builder who breaks things

Understanding how systems fail makes autonomous AI systems safer. Security-first engineering for the age of AI agents.

0
Years Experience
0
Bugs Reported
0
Projects Delivered

🤖 AI Agent Security

Securing autonomous agent systems — prompt injection defense, tenant data isolation, tool privilege escalation prevention, and output verification layers for multi-agent workflows.

🔎 Bug Bounty Hunter

Active on HackerOne across major platforms including Robinhood and Airbnb. Specializing in web applications, APIs, and backend systems. From IDOR to RCE.

🛡 Penetration Testing

Manual and automated testing of web applications, APIs, and infrastructure. Thinking like an attacker so your autonomous systems don't face one unprepared.

🏗 Security Architecture

Building security into architecture from day one. Authentication flows, authorization models, data encryption, secure API design, and agent guardrail systems.

Let's build something autonomous

Building an AI-native product? Need multi-agent orchestration that works in production? Looking for an engineer who understands both the AI layer and the infrastructure underneath? Let's talk.

dhruvgupta1992@gmail.com → GitHub ↗